Total War: Warhammer 2 – Malus Darkblade Campaign Gameplay Preview

The Shadow and The Blade DLC for Total War: Warhammer 2 was revealed earlier this week, and ahead of its release on the 12th of December, Creative Assembly has released their first gameplay preview. The preview video focuses on the campaign of Malus Darkblade, the new Dark Elf Legendary Lord. Malus has unique campaign mechanics, including a dial that gauges his current level of daemonic possession…

The Shadow and The Blade DLC – Malus Darkblade’s Campaign

Malus Darkblade’s specific Lord and Faction Effects have yet to be revealed. However, the new video does give players an indication of what his campaign will be like, and from the looks of it, it should be a refreshing take on the Dark Elf campaign. In Total War: Warhammer 2’s Eye of the Vortex campaign, all of the game’s original four factions have functionally the same campaign mechanics. Each race is competing with the other three to gather a unique resource. After collecting enough, they can undertake multi-turn rituals during which time they must defend three settlements from attacking armies.

However, the factions which have come to the game post-launch, the Tomb Kings and Vampire Coast, have their own unique campaign mechanics instead. Markus Wulfhart and Nakai the Wanderer also do, even though Nakai is from one of the original four factions. Malus Darkblade, it seems, will have something of a hybrid set of campaign mechanics. He does participate in the race to control the Vortex, like the other Dark Elf Legendary Lords. However, he also has unique mechanics of his own to manage simultaneously.

As can be seen in the gameplay preview video, Malus Darkblade has a dial on his campaign map UI which represents his current level of possession by Tz’arkan. The stronger this possession grows, the more powerful Malus becomes in battle. However, the more penalties his faction takes on the campaign map. To control this possession, he must acquire a special elixir. However, Malekith is withholding this elixir in order to coerce Malus into aiding his goal of controlling the Vortex. Malus also receives special missions during his campaign from Tz’arkan; missions which he can complete to earn powerful reward items and followers.
